// IOSurface pool — reuse freed surfaces of the same size
#define IOSURF_POOL_MAX 128
static struct {
IOSurfaceRef surfaces[IOSURF_POOL_MAX];
size_t sizes[IOSURF_POOL_MAX];
int count;
} g_iosurf_pool = { .count = 0 };
static IOSurfaceRef make_surface(size_t bytes) {
// Check pool for matching size
for (int i = 0; i < g_iosurf_pool.count; i++) {
if (g_iosurf_pool.sizes[i] == bytes) {
IOSurfaceRef s = g_iosurf_pool.surfaces[i];
// Swap-remove
g_iosurf_pool.surfaces[i] = g_iosurf_pool.surfaces[--g_iosurf_pool.count];
g_iosurf_pool.sizes[i] = g_iosurf_pool.sizes[g_iosurf_pool.count];
return s;
}
}
return IOSurfaceCreate((__bridge CFDictionaryRef)@{
(id)kIOSurfaceWidth:@(bytes), (id)kIOSurfaceHeight:@1,
(id)kIOSurfaceBytesPerElement:@1, (id)kIOSurfaceBytesPerRow:@(bytes),
(id)kIOSurfaceAllocSize:@(bytes), (id)kIOSurfacePixelFormat:@0});
}
static void pool_return_surface(IOSurfaceRef s, size_t bytes) {
if (g_iosurf_pool.count < IOSURF_POOL_MAX) {
g_iosurf_pool.surfaces[g_iosurf_pool.count] = s;
g_iosurf_pool.sizes[g_iosurf_pool.count] = bytes;
g_iosurf_pool.count++;
} else {
CFRelease(s);
}
}
